Kinds Of Asbestos Lawsuits
Individual Injury Lawsuits: These are submitted by people who have been identified with asbestos-related health problems. Plaintiffs seek compensation from accountable celebrations.

Wrongful Death Lawsuits: If an individual passes away due to an asbestos-related disease, member of the family may file a lawsuit to seek damages for their loss.

Class Action Lawsuits: Groups of individuals who have been likewise affected can sign up with together to file a lawsuit against a typical defendant, often large corporations.

Trust Fund Claims: Many business that utilized asbestos have actually established trust funds to compensate victims. People can submit claims against these funds for compensation.

Can I submit a lawsuit if I was exposed to asbestos years ago?
Yes, you can file a lawsuit regardless of when the exposure took place, but there are statutes of limitations that differ by state. It is crucial to speak with a lawyer to understand your particular timeframe.
2. How long does the lawsuit process take?
The period of an asbestos lawsuit can differ extensively, varying from several months to years, depending on the intricacy of the case and whether a settlement is reached.
3. Exists a cost to submit an asbestos lawsuit?
Many attorneys deal with a contingency fee basis, indicating they just get paid if you win your case. They will usually cover the in advance expenses associated with submitting the lawsuit.
4. What if the responsible business is bankrupt?
Lots of companies that dealt with asbestos-related suits have applied for bankruptcy. However, much of these companies have actually set up trust funds to compensate victims. Your lawyer can direct you on how to sue versus these funds.
